Creatures sketchbook

Mixed media, mostly from gelatin monoprints. From an on-line workshop by Carla Sonheim, last year. Not really satisfied, but what the hell. I have a lot more monoprints to work on really beastly political creatures, not on cute ones. The above is unfinished, but I don't know if I will complete the pages any time.

Hello raingirl. Gelatin monoprints are prints made on a gelatin plate. I make one myself but today there is a commercial one available. It is more or less like prints made on a glass plate, since every one different they are called Monotypes. What makes the technique different form a glass print is that the gelatin is more flexible and holds more humidity which allows for more details and a different effect and quality.
